Description
Been using Feel The Wear 2 Notifications for a couple months now. It’s basically an app that lets you set custom vibration patterns and sounds for your Android watch’s notifications. Pretty solid if you’re into tweaking your device’s notification experience.
Here’s what you do: you can choose from pre-made vibration patterns or create your own custom ones. There’s also an option to upload your own audio files as notification sounds, which is pretty cool. And there’s an hourly chime feature – took me a while to figure that out but it’s useful if you want a little nudge every hour.
Look, if you’re into customizing your watch and making sure you don’t miss any important notifications, you’ll probably like this. It’s not perfect – the vibrations can be a bit weak sometimes – but overall it does the job. Worth checking out.

Pros & Cons
Pros
- Tons of customization options for vibrations and sounds
- Can upload your own audio files as notification tones
- Hourly chime feature is handy
- Works well with modern Wear OS 3 watches
Cons
- Vibrations can be a bit weak even on strongest setting
- Took me a while to figure out some of the features
- Requires disabling battery optimizations on your phone
